What is Overwatering and Why is it Harmful?
Overwatering doesn't mean giving your plant too much water at once; it means watering too frequently or keeping the soil constantly soggy. This creates an environment where plant roots effectively "drown" due to a lack of oxygen, leading to their decay and eventual plant death. It's a silent killer that often mimics symptoms of underwatering.
How Does Overwatering Harm Plants?
- Root Suffocation: Plant roots need oxygen to respire (breathe) and absorb nutrients. When soil is constantly waterlogged, the water fills all the air pockets, depriving roots of oxygen.
- Root Rot: In anaerobic (oxygen-deprived) conditions, beneficial soil microbes die off, and harmful anaerobic bacteria and fungi (like Pythium and Phytophthora) thrive. These pathogens attack and decay the plant's roots, turning them mushy and ineffective. This is known as root rot.
- Nutrient Deficiency: Damaged or rotting roots cannot absorb water or essential nutrients, even if they are present in the soil. This leads to symptoms like yellowing leaves and stunted growth.
- Weakened Plant: An overwatered plant is stressed and weakened, making it more susceptible to pests and other diseases.
- Algae and Fungus Gnats: Constantly wet soil provides an ideal breeding ground for algae on the soil surface and nuisance pests like fungus gnats.
What Does Overwatering Look Like?
The symptoms of overwatering can be confusing because they often mimic underwatering. However, inspecting the soil and roots usually provides the definitive answer.
- Wilting Leaves: Plants wilt even when the soil is wet. This is because the rotted roots can't transport water to the leaves.
- Yellowing Leaves: Leaves turn yellow, often starting with older, lower leaves. They might feel soft or mushy.
- Stunted or Slowed Growth: The plant simply stops growing or grows very slowly.
- Dropping Leaves: Leaves may fall off, sometimes still green, or after turning yellow.
- Mushy Stems or Base: The stem at or just above the soil line may turn dark, soft, or mushy.
- Moldy or Algae Growth on Soil Surface: A green or white fuzzy growth on the top of the soil.
- Foul Odor: The soil may develop a sour, rotten, or mildewy smell due to anaerobic decomposition.
- Root Appearance (if inspected): Healthy roots are firm and white or light tan. Overwatered roots will be brown, black, soft, and mushy, often with a foul odor.
How to Prevent Overwatering in Containers
The key to preventing overwatering in containers is to create an environment where excess water can drain away quickly and roots can access oxygen. This involves smart choices in pots, potting mix, and, most importantly, your watering habits.
1. Always Use Pots with Drainage Holes
This is the most crucial step to avoid overwatering.
- Essential Requirement: Never plant in a container without drainage holes at the bottom. Without them, water collects at the base, creating a perpetually soggy environment for roots.
- Saucers: Use a saucer or tray underneath the pot to catch excess water, but always empty it promptly after watering. Don't let the pot sit in standing water.
- Drill Your Own: If you fall in love with a beautiful decorative pot that lacks holes, drill them yourself (if possible) or use it as a cachepot (a decorative outer pot) for a plant that is in a plastic pot with drainage.
2. Choose the Right Potting Mix
The soil you use is critical for proper drainage and aeration.
- Not Garden Soil: Never use heavy garden soil, topsoil, or dense clay in containers. These compact easily and don't drain well, leading to root rot.
- Well-Draining Potting Mix: Always use a high-quality, lightweight potting mix for containers. These mixes are specially formulated to provide good drainage and aeration while retaining some moisture.
- Amendments for Extra Drainage: For plants that truly hate wet feet (like succulents, cacti, or herbs that prefer drier conditions), you can amend a standard potting mix with additional perlite, coarse sand, or pumice to improve drainage further. A good rule of thumb is 1 part potting mix to 1 part perlite/pumice.
- Avoid "Drainage Layers": Do NOT put gravel, broken pot pieces, or packing peanuts at the bottom of the pot. This actually hinders drainage by creating a "perched water table" just above the gravel layer, keeping the soil above it soggy for longer. The best drainage happens when the entire soil column drains freely.
3. Implement Smart Watering Techniques
This is where most overwatering occurs. Proper watering is about when and how much.
- The "Feel Test" is Key: Do NOT water on a strict schedule. Instead, always check the soil moisture before watering. Stick your finger 1-2 inches deep into the soil (or deeper for larger pots). Only water if it feels dry at that depth.
- For most plants: Water when the top 1-2 inches are dry.
- For succulents/cacti/drought-tolerant plants: Let the soil dry out almost completely between waterings.
- Weight Test: For smaller pots, you can lift the pot when it's dry and when it's just watered. The difference in weight will give you an idea of when to water.
- Moisture Meter: A soil moisture meter can provide an accurate reading of moisture levels at different depths.
- Water Thoroughly, But Infrequently: When you water, water deeply and slowly until water flows freely out of the drainage holes at the bottom. This ensures the entire root ball is saturated. Then, allow the excess water to drain completely. Discard any standing water in the saucer after 15-30 minutes.
- Bottom Watering (for some plants): For sensitive plants or those prone to damping-off, you can place the pot in a shallow tray of water and let the soil wick up moisture from the bottom. Remove when the top of the soil feels moist.
- Adjust for Conditions: Your watering frequency will change with seasons, temperature, humidity, light, and plant growth. Plants need more water in hot, sunny, dry conditions and less in cool, cloudy, humid conditions. Dormant plants need significantly less water.
4. Choose the Right Pot Size
An overly large pot can lead to overwatering.
- Energy Diversion: When a plant is in a pot that's too large, it puts its energy into filling that vast soil volume with roots before focusing on foliage or flowering.
- Slow Drying: The large volume of soil in an oversized pot takes a very long time to dry out, increasing the risk of perpetually soggy conditions and root rot.
- Best Practice: When repotting, only go up one pot size (e.g., from a 6-inch to an 8-inch pot). Repot only when the plant is root-bound (roots circling the pot, growing out of drainage holes).
5. Consider Pot Material
The material of your container influences how quickly the soil dries out.
- Terracotta/Unglazed Clay: Porous and "breathes," allowing moisture to evaporate through the sides. This helps soil dry out faster, reducing overwatering risk. Great for plants that prefer drier conditions.
- Plastic/Glazed Ceramic: Non-porous, so water only evaporates from the top and drainage holes. These retain moisture longer. Good for plants that like consistently moist (but not soggy) soil, but require more careful watering.
- Fabric Pots ("Smart Pots"): Excellent for preventing overwatering. The fabric allows for "air pruning" of roots, which prevents circling roots and promotes healthy root structure. They also promote excellent drainage and aeration through the sides. Fabric grow bags are a fantastic choice for many outdoor container vegetables.
6. Improve Air Circulation
Good airflow around your plants and containers helps with evaporation.
- Spacing: Don't crowd containers together, especially indoors. Give plants enough space for air to circulate around them.
- Elevate Pots: Use pot feet or risers to lift pots slightly off the ground or saucer. This improves airflow under the pot and ensures drainage holes aren't blocked.
- Small Fan: Indoors, a small oscillating fan on a low setting for a few hours a day can improve air circulation and help dry the soil surface.
7. Monitor Plant Health
Your plants will give you clues about their watering needs.
- Observe Leaves: Wilting, yellowing, or browning leaves can indicate watering issues.
- Check Growth: Stunted growth can be a sign of stressed roots.
- Look for Pests: Overwatered plants are weaker and more susceptible to pests like fungus gnats (which thrive in moist soil).
How to Rescue an Overwatered Plant
If you've identified an overwatered plant, act quickly. While not always successful, early intervention can save your plant from root rot.
1. Stop Watering Immediately
This is the first and most critical step. Do not water again until you've assessed the situation and the soil has dried out significantly.
2. Improve Drainage and Airflow
- Remove Excess Water: Empty any standing water from the saucer.
- Tilt the Pot: For very soggy pots, gently tilt the container to help excess water drain out.
- Loosen Soil: If the soil surface is compacted, gently aerate it by poking a few holes with a chopstick or pencil. Be careful not to damage roots.
- Increase Air Circulation: Move the plant to a spot with better air circulation. If indoors, place it near an open window (but out of drafts) or use a small fan.
3. Inspect and Prune Roots (If Necessary and Possible)
This step is primarily for plants that can be easily removed from their pots, like houseplants.
- Gently Remove Plant: Carefully slide the plant out of its pot. Try to keep the root ball as intact as possible.
- Examine Roots: Shake off excess wet soil. Look for healthy, firm, white/tan roots. Identify damaged roots: they will be brown, black, mushy, slimy, or have a foul odor.
- Prune Rotted Roots: Using clean, sharp pruning shears or scissors, cut away all diseased, mushy roots. Cut into healthy white tissue. Disinfect your tools after each cut.
- Repot (if needed):
- If the roots were severely rotted and pruned, consider repotting into a slightly smaller, clean pot with fresh, well-draining potting mix.
- Do not reuse the old, potentially contaminated soil.
- Do not water immediately after repotting; wait a few days to allow roots to heal.
4. Provide Optimal Conditions for Recovery
- Light: Place the struggling plant in a bright, indirect light location. Avoid direct, harsh sun, which can add more stress.
- Avoid Fertilizing: Do not fertilize an overwatered or stressed plant. Wait until it shows signs of recovery and new growth.
- Patience: Recovery takes time. It can take weeks or even months for a plant to bounce back from severe overwatering. Some plants may not recover at all if root damage is too extensive.
